Synopsis

Port Number: 0006

Function: Unknown

Details

This port seems to affect the display refresh.

Bit [0]

Latches value written, no apparent effect.

Bit [1]

Reset this bit to disable display upadates.

Bit [2]

Set this bit to enable display updates if bit 1 is ever reset. ???

This bit is known to unlock protected ports, such as SHA256, and enables the flash unlock sequence. It is cleared every time the boot code interrupt handler runs.

Bit [3]

Writes do not latch; no apparent effect.

Bit [4]

Flash lock status.

Bits [7:3]

Writes do not latch; no apparent effect.
